Summary:
The main function of an administrative assistant/executive assistant is to provide high-level administrative support by conducting research, handling information requests and performing clerical functions. A typical administrative assistant acts as information and communication managers for an office.

Job Responsibilities:
• Supervise general office duties such as ordering supplies, maintaining records management systems, and performing basic bookkeeping work.
• Review and approve invoices, reports, memos, letters, financial statements, and other documents.
• Review and approve corporate documents, records, and reports.
• Read and analyze incoming memos, submissions, and reports to determine their significance and plan their distribution.
• Prepare agendas and make arrangements for committee, board and other meetings.
• Make arrangements for travel, planning meetings, etc.

Skills:
• Verbal and written communication skills, multi-tasking, customer service skills and interpersonal skills.
• Strong ability to work independently and manage one’s time.
• Strong ability to keep information organized and confidential.
• Strong ability in event planning.
• Strong leadership and mentoring skills necessary to provide support and constructive performance feedback.
• Previous experience with computer applications, such as Microsoft Word, Excel and PowerPoint.

Education/Experience:
• High school diploma or GED required.
• 6-8 years experience required.
• Experience working with executives required.
